Black Mountain Family Reunion, Colorado’s favorite grass roots festival, returns for its sixth year. Last year’s festival was the first to feature a theme, Alice In Wonderland, and this year will follow suit with Star Wars! Put on by Whiskey Tango and their dedicated family and friends BMFR will feature some of Colorado’s best talent as well as acts from outside the state. Nate Todd was born on the central plains of Nebraska, but grew up on the high plains of the Texas panhandle. With not much to do in either place, music was his constant companion. His parents dubbed the first two albums he ever owned onto a tape for him. Side A was Bert and Ernie’s Sing Along. Side B was Sgt. Peppers. His lifelong love affair with music started early as he practically grew up in a Rock & Roll band, with his father and uncle often taking him out on the road or into the studio with them. Nate began performing live at sixteen and hasn’t looked back, having played in numerous bands from L.A. to Austin. At the age of twenty he was bitten by the writing bug, and upon moving to Denver decided to pursue a degree from Metropolitan State University where he recently graduated with a B.A. in English and a minor in Cinema Studies.
